Disable cfi-icall checks for CEF bindings (issue #2472)

This commit is contained in:
Marshall Greenblatt
2018-07-12 10:55:56 -07:00
parent 10c01ff43e
commit 0d12959a50
145 changed files with 1981 additions and 923 deletions

View File

@@ -9,7 +9,7 @@
// implementations. See the translator.README.txt file in the tools directory
// for more information.
//
// $hash=b35c8a8c174026cbafddcfc80f3ba33a8a42bf69$
// $hash=df4659596e0506371b6d04a753d129aca585a7a4$
//
#include "libcef_dll/ctocpp/stream_reader_ctocpp.h"
@@ -17,6 +17,7 @@
// STATIC METHODS - Body may be edited by hand.
NO_SANITIZE("cfi-icall")
CefRefPtr<CefStreamReader> CefStreamReader::CreateForFile(
const CefString& fileName) {
// AUTO-GENERATED CONTENT - DELETE THIS COMMENT BEFORE MODIFYING
@@ -34,6 +35,7 @@ CefRefPtr<CefStreamReader> CefStreamReader::CreateForFile(
return CefStreamReaderCToCpp::Wrap(_retval);
}
NO_SANITIZE("cfi-icall")
CefRefPtr<CefStreamReader> CefStreamReader::CreateForData(void* data,
size_t size) {
// AUTO-GENERATED CONTENT - DELETE THIS COMMENT BEFORE MODIFYING
@@ -50,6 +52,7 @@ CefRefPtr<CefStreamReader> CefStreamReader::CreateForData(void* data,
return CefStreamReaderCToCpp::Wrap(_retval);
}
NO_SANITIZE("cfi-icall")
CefRefPtr<CefStreamReader> CefStreamReader::CreateForHandler(
CefRefPtr<CefReadHandler> handler) {
// AUTO-GENERATED CONTENT - DELETE THIS COMMENT BEFORE MODIFYING
@@ -69,6 +72,7 @@ CefRefPtr<CefStreamReader> CefStreamReader::CreateForHandler(
// VIRTUAL METHODS - Body may be edited by hand.
NO_SANITIZE("cfi-icall")
size_t CefStreamReaderCToCpp::Read(void* ptr, size_t size, size_t n) {
cef_stream_reader_t* _struct = GetStruct();
if (CEF_MEMBER_MISSING(_struct, read))
@@ -88,6 +92,7 @@ size_t CefStreamReaderCToCpp::Read(void* ptr, size_t size, size_t n) {
return _retval;
}
NO_SANITIZE("cfi-icall")
int CefStreamReaderCToCpp::Seek(int64 offset, int whence) {
cef_stream_reader_t* _struct = GetStruct();
if (CEF_MEMBER_MISSING(_struct, seek))
@@ -102,7 +107,7 @@ int CefStreamReaderCToCpp::Seek(int64 offset, int whence) {
return _retval;
}
int64 CefStreamReaderCToCpp::Tell() {
NO_SANITIZE("cfi-icall") int64 CefStreamReaderCToCpp::Tell() {
cef_stream_reader_t* _struct = GetStruct();
if (CEF_MEMBER_MISSING(_struct, tell))
return 0;
@@ -116,7 +121,7 @@ int64 CefStreamReaderCToCpp::Tell() {
return _retval;
}
int CefStreamReaderCToCpp::Eof() {
NO_SANITIZE("cfi-icall") int CefStreamReaderCToCpp::Eof() {
cef_stream_reader_t* _struct = GetStruct();
if (CEF_MEMBER_MISSING(_struct, eof))
return 0;
@@ -130,7 +135,7 @@ int CefStreamReaderCToCpp::Eof() {
return _retval;
}
bool CefStreamReaderCToCpp::MayBlock() {
NO_SANITIZE("cfi-icall") bool CefStreamReaderCToCpp::MayBlock() {
cef_stream_reader_t* _struct = GetStruct();
if (CEF_MEMBER_MISSING(_struct, may_block))
return false;